[dokuwiki] Re: javascript with php global variables

  • From: Michiel Kamermans <pomax@xxxxxxxxxxxxxxxxxxxx>
  • To: dokuwiki@xxxxxxxxxxxxx
  • Date: Tue, 17 Nov 2009 23:13:27 -0800

James Lin wrote:
Hi Michiel,

to answer "why", think about this scenario, I write a plugin to set the ACL for the displaying page. So when I click a button, a popup window loads the existing page ACL and render it to the popup, then I change the permission and click OK, popup disappears, made the ACL changes at the backend without reloading the main page.
But this violates ACL, though, doesn't it? Now you have an already loaded page with buttons that let you do, for instance, administrative tasks while the backend doesn't consider you an admin. You now have a dokuwiki that's effectively in an "illegal state"...?

- Michiel
